Implantation metastasis in ureter from a colonic adenocarcinoma
Scandinavian Journal of Urology and Nephrology
|January 5, 2002
Abstract:
Metastasis to the ureter is very rare. In most published cases, the diagnosis is only made at postmortem examination or when gross metastasis is present. This report presents a case in which the metastasis from a colonic tumour occluded the ureteral lumen from inside.
